Baraboo Public Library

Baraboo Public Library, serving an area of 21,000 residents, has a collection of 84,000 books and periodicals; in addition, there are 3,100 CDs, records, cassettes and other audio materials, as well as 2,500 video items, such as DVDs and VHS tapes. Internet terminals are available for use by the general public.

Staffing consists of 12 employees, including one fully accredited librarian, plus volunteers. Annual expenditures on the library collection total $69,000. Patrons make 120,000 visits annually, and check out materials 230,000 times. Forty percent of all check-outs are children's materials.

Location: 230 Fourth Ave., Baraboo Wisconsin 53913 Telephone 608-356-6166
